Tommy Schabert Obituary

Thomas John Schabert, 72, Mankato, passed away September 17, 2023 at home with his family by his side.  A Celebration of Tommy's Life will be held from 1-3pm Saturday October 14, 2023 at The Venue, 1850 Madison Ave Suite 200, Mankato MN.  

Tommy was born April 11, 1951 to Joseph and Katherine (Garaghty) Schabert in St. Peter.  He was united in marriage to Jane (Wellnitz) Kirby on November 29, 1999 in Branson, MO.  Tommy worked 38 years as a mechanic for the City of Mankato retiring in August 2014. 

He was involved in Scouting, enjoyed primitive camping and was very proud of all three of his boys earning their Eagle Scout.  His garage was his castle and he loved his tools.  Tommy could never pass up buying a flashlight or tape measure even though he already had many at home.  He wasn’t afraid of a challenge to try things that he didn’t know how to do himself, teaching himself new skills.    He also was willing to teach his skills to others and enjoyed helping others.   Tommy also enjoyed refurbishing laptops, often driving many miles to find the best deals on them. Tommy enjoyed retirement when he could finally do what he wanted when he wanted.  He liked to go out for coffee weekly with the guys.  He enjoyed people and his neighbors.  Tommy also enjoyed playing Pokémon Go with his grandson, Bellamy.

Tommy is survived by his wife, Jane Schabert; his sons, Mark (Erika) Schabert, Dan (Heidi) Schabert, and Paul (Kayla) Schabert; daughter Becky (Matt) Westberg and step-daughter Keely (partner Derek) Unruh; grandchildren, Caleb, Luke, Peter, Joel, Charity, Lydia, Micah, Jenna, Bree, Brandy and Bellamy; brother, Robert (Bernie) Schabert; and sisters, Pat (Ron) Gaines and Geri McMichael. 

He is preceded in death by his parents; brothers, Mike, Larry, and Joe; and sisters, Diane and Kathleen. 

His memory will live on in the hearts of all those who loved him.
